Broken and Damaged Fascia
Fascias are board-like structures that run horizontally along the roofline and hold the guttering in place. With time, direct exposure to the components can trigger them to break or end up being deformed. Prompt replacement or repair of the fascia can avoid water from leaking into the roofing and harming the structure of the home.
2. Soffit Decay
Soffits cover the area below the roofline, offering ventilation and avoiding bugs from getting in the attic. Moisture can trigger soffits to rot, jeopardizing their functionality. Replacement of harmed soffits can boost both visual appeals and ventilation.
3. Gutter Maintenance
Rain gutters gather rainwater from the roofing system and funnel it far from the home's foundation. When rain gutters are clogged with debris, they can overflow, causing considerable water damage. Regular cleaning and maintenance are important to guarantee correct drain.
4. Inspecting Downpipes
Downpipes channel water from seamless gutters down to a drainage system. Disconnections or obstructions in these pipes can lead to water pooling, which can deteriorate the structure. Routine checks are necessary to make sure all components are undamaged.

FAQs about Roofline Repairs
1. How typically should I examine my roofline?
It is advisable to examine your roofline at least as soon as a year, preferably throughout the spring and fall.
2. What signs show a need for roofline repairs?
Signs include visible fractures, peeling paint on fascias, clogged seamless gutters, and drooping soffits.
3. Can I repair roofline problems in the winter season months?
While some minor repairs might be feasible, it is usually best to wait for warmer weather condition due to the danger of ice and snow.
4. How can I prolong the life of my roofline?
Routine maintenance, such as cleaning up gutters and checking for damage, can significantly extend the life-span of roofline components.
